Abstract

The perturbation approach is used to derive the exact correlation length ξ of the dilute AL lattice models in regimes 1 and 2 for L odd. In regime 2 the A3 model is the E8 lattice realization of the two-dimensional Ising model in a magnetic field h at T = Tc. When combined with the singular part fs of the free energy the result for the A3 model gives the universal amplitude fsξ2 = 0.061 728 . . . as h → 0 in precise agreement with the result obtained by Delfino and Mussardo via the form-factor bootstrap approach.
